5 Ingredient Mexican Rice

Total Time 30 minutes
Servings 6

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up uncooked long-grain rice
  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1/2 cup salsa
  • 1 teaspoon garlic salt

Instructions
 

  • Combine all ingredients into a medium, non-stick skillet or pot.  Bring to a boil, then cover and reduce heat to low. Simmer for 25 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and let rice stand with lid on for about 10 minutes.  Remove the lid and fluff the rice with a fork.  Serve alongside just about anything or inside delicious homemade tacos with Mexican shredded chicken!
